Arc spaces of cA_1 singularities

Abstract
Let p be a singular point of a complex hypersurface whose tangent cone is a quadric of rank at least 3. We show that the space of arcs through p is irreducible. Using a method of de Fernex, this shows that the Nash problem has a negative answer for x^2+y^2+z^2+t^5=0. Version 2: Several small corrections.
